✨Join a group of passionate advocates on our mission to improve the lives of youth!  Rite of Passage Team is hiring for a Unit Manager at Western Secure Treatment Unit in Emlenton, Pennsylvania

Western Secure Treatment Unit (WSTU) is a secure post-adjudication facility that provides comprehensive services to young women (14-21), using a trauma-informed, strength-based, gender responsive model. Through rigorous education, positive skill development, and individualized therapeutic interventions and treatment, we empower youth to reach their full potential. The facility features residential student dormitories, on-site schooling, a vocational CTE student work training program, a dining hall, and extracurricular opportunities for the young men. What you will do:  The Unit Manager adheres to the facility schedule, ensures the unit is on time for all elements and completes daily assignments as specified by the Director of Group Living; oversees the daily schedule, including the PM Program, to ensure it operates on time and the students participate in all of the scheduled activities as listed on the PM schedule; and oversees all program elements efficiently to promote positive behavioral traits with the students.  Ensures Group Leaders are supervising all elements effectively to reduce incidents.  This person acts as head coach, team supervisor or program element supervisor at all times, and in conjunction with the Program Director and Director of Group Living, facilitates all extra-curricular and community service activities and facilitates the scheduled Positive Skill Development Group meetings, as well, as reviews student Daily Assessment Program Notes.


To be considered you should: Possess a Bachelors Degree in a related field or any equivalent combination numbers of years’ experience, education and/or training that demonstrates the ability to perform the duties of the position.  Military experience and training is acceptable.  Three (3) years of experience in a juvenile treatment (Residential, Behavioral, Dentition, Corrections, etc.) Related and/or equivalent experience may be substituted with approval ~ One (1) year supervisory experience ~ Be at least 21 years of age ~ Be able to pass a criminal background check, drug screen (we no longer test for THC for pre-employment), physical, and TB test ~ Be able to pass a search of the child abuse central registry.

Schedule:  A rotating schedule of 5 days on, 2 days off, days off will vary.

What We Do

Rite of Passage is a leading national provider of programs and services for troubled and at-risk youth. With 35 years of experience in the juvenile justice industry, Rite of Passage has multiple service divisions that work with nearly 2,000 youth and families daily including schools, community-based services, academic-model programs, gender-specific treatment and secure facilities. The agency and its staff provide targeted services, skill-building opportunities and rich programming that promote youth success within their community, and for life.
